Diana Damrau

Diana Damrau

1 title Acting May 31, 1971 Günzburg, Germany

Diana Damrau, a distinguished soprano, has graced the foremost opera and concert venues around the world for over twenty years. Her impressive repertoire includes leading roles in numerous acclaimed operas, showcasing her remarkable vocal prowess and versatility. Among her notable performances are the title roles in *Anna Bolena* at the Zurich Opera House and Vienna State Opera, *I Masnadieri* at the Bavarian State Opera, and *Roméo et Juliette* at both La Scala and the Metropolitan Opera.

Damrau has also captivated audiences with her portrayals in *Lucia di Lammermoor*, performed at prestigious venues including La Scala, the Bavarian State Opera, the Metropolitan Opera, and the Royal Opera House. Her interpretation of Manon at the Vienna State Opera and the Metropolitan Opera further solidified her status as a leading soprano. Additionally, she is celebrated for her role as the Queen of the Night in *Die Zauberflöte*, enchanting audiences at the Metropolitan Opera, Salzburg Festival, and other renowned theaters.

In a notable career highlight, Damrau is set to debut as Gräfin Madeleine in *Capriccio* at the Bavarian State Opera in July 2022, marking another significant milestone in her illustrious career.
